Q: How often should protein requirements be reassessed for CKD patients?
A: Protein requirements for CKD patients should be reassessed regularly, typically during follow-up appointments with healthcare providers, to ensure they align with changes in the patient’s condition, treatment plan, and nutritional needs.
Q: Are there any dietary restrictions for CKD patients in addition to protein intake?
A: Yes, CKD patients may also need to restrict other nutrients such as sodium, phosphorus, and potassium, depending on their individual condition and stage of kidney disease. Dietary counseling from a healthcare professional, such as a dietitian, is essential for comprehensive nutritional management.
